Clay Jensen experienced dramatic changes in his life before. The earliest, most significant shift was when at the age of seven he became a brother.
It didn’t happen the common way that included nine months of pregnancy and preparation. Instead, Justin’s arrival pretty much happened overnight. And Clay’s brother didn’t arrive as a baby, but a five year old boy, insecure and sullen and miserable.
But in a way it was a process, too. And it took even longer than the usual nine months of pregnancy — between Justin’s first day in their home and the day he finally became an official family member, a year and a half passed. A year and a half that affected the whole family’s lives and future.
When his cell phone rings on a quiet Friday night in early January, roughly twenty-five years later, Clay has no idea that it’s going to be the start of a whole lot of new changes — life altering changes for each member of his family.
He just answers the phone.
